REPORTS TO:             Clinical Services Director

JOB SUMMARY:     The RN Charge Nurse will perform the primary functions of a professional leader in assessing, planning, directing and evaluating patient care on the medical-surgical unit or the Emergency room department; as well as in supervising staff, and managing equipment and supplies.

ESSENTIAL TASKS/DUTIES:

 (This list is a succinct summary of core duties only. Other tasks will be assigned)

  1. Assures that physician orders are compiled accurately and promptly.
  2. Makes rounds which sufficiently assess acuity, patient/family satisfaction, and staff accomplishments relative to patient needs.
  3. Assists nursing staff with problems and problem-solving.
  4. Consults with Medical Staff to coordinate plans of care.
  5. Responsible for nursing care delivery quality, supervision of staff, appropriate assignments of duties and management of applicable equipment and supplies.
  6. Serves as liaison and maintains communication with physicians, other hospital departments and patient care units to assure quality patient care.
  7. Oversees patient admissions, transfers & discharges.
  8. Identifies issues or emergencies & responds in a calm & efficient manner.

QUALIFICATIONS:

  1. Must be a graduate of an accredited school of Professional Nursing with a Bachelor’s degree in Nursing preferred.
  2. Must have and maintain a current RN license issued by the State of Texas.
  3. Must have adequate department training.
  4. Must have and maintain current required certifications.
  5. Must demonstrate the ability to engage in effective verbal and written communication.
  6. Duties require intermittent walking, sitting, standing, pulling, bending, stooping and reaching to perform tasks and be able to lift objects that may weigh as much as 50 lbs.
